This is the removal of unwanted plants on the farm
Answer Details
The correct answer is: Weeding.
"Weeding" refers to the process of removing unwanted plants from a farm or garden to help the desired plants grow better.
"Thinning" usually refers to the removal of excess plants to allow the remaining plants to grow stronger and healthier.
"Mulching" refers to the practice of covering the soil with a layer of material (such as leaves, straw, or bark) to retain moisture, suppress weed growth, and improve soil quality.
"Supplying" does not relate to the removal of unwanted plants on a farm. It could refer to the act of providing necessary resources, such as water or nutrients, to the desired plants.
